csckid Posted September 9, 2010 Share Posted September 9, 2010 I'm passing variable through GET method. What can be the maximum length of the variable? http://localhost/my.php?variable1='abc'&variable2='cdf' Q) What can the total length of URL? bh Posted September 9, 2010 Share Posted September 9, 2010 Hi, You can get the entiry URL with $_SERVER['REQUEST_URI']. And you can get info about the string length with strlen.
